      "q": "Is the salary CTC or in-hand?",
      "a": "Most Indian schools quote annual CTC. In-hand is lower than CTC once employee PF (12% of basic, capped at ₹15,000 basic/month), professional tax and — where applicable — income tax under the new regime are deducted.
